Good morning. Earlier today, district administration was made aware that a student brought one 9mm bullet to school at CES. Local law enforcement and the CES threat assessment team were immediately contacted. Please know the student did not make any threats, and it was determined no students are in danger. We simply write to inform you of this incident because it is our belief to be honest and transparent with parents about what happens at school. Our district takes this matter very seriously and disciplinary actions will be taken in accordance with state law and our school code. The safety and security of our students will always be our top priority. Lastly, we believe this situation is a good opportunity for you to talk to your child or children about bringing inappropriate items to school and the potential disciplinary action that could result from bringing prohibited items to school. When speaking to your child or children, please remind them if they see something, say something. Today’s incident was resolved in a quick and safe manner because students reported the incident to administration.

Late this evening, we were made aware of a possible threat to school safety that was posted on social media. Immediately, with the help of the Christopher Police Department, we began the process of conducting a thorough investigation into the matter. The social media post has been deemed not credible. The well-being of our students is our top priority, so we wanted to inform you of this incident and assure you it is safe for your child to attend school. We want to thank the Christopher Police Department and ISP for their quick and professional response.
